Case Study

A prominent structural engineering firm faced bloated file sizes and unacceptably slow load times due to exploded blocks scattered across legacy drawings. By running BricsCAD's automated AI Blockify feature, the software autonomously identified repetitive geometry and converted them into highly efficient block definitions. This optimization reduced overall file sizes by 40%, significantly speeding up their downstream CAM processing and drafting efficiency.

4

ChatGPT (for AutoLISP)

The Ultimate AI Scripting Assistant

A seasoned CAD programmer sitting right on your keyboard.

What It's For

Generating complex AutoLISP scripts and automating custom AutoCAD commands through intuitive natural language prompts.

Pros

Rapid generation of custom AutoLISP routines and workflow macros; Easily accessible and highly versatile for general CAD problem-solving; Excellent at debugging and repairing existing broken CAD scripts

Cons

Requires advanced prompt engineering skills to get workable code; Frequently hallucinates functions that do not exist in the AutoCAD API
